MKA USA Response to the Oklahoma Tragedy

The leaders and membership of Majlis-Khuddamul Ahmadiyya USA, the Ahmadiyya Muslim Youth Organization, maintain solidarity with the people of Oklahoma and Texas. We too acknowledge the pain of families in Moore and Newcastle Oklahoma as well as all the areas affected. Our thoughts and prayers are with them and we are supportive of them in their long journey to recovery. As believing youth, we recognize that there are many questions that come up when loss of life, property and peace of mind occur. In spite of these challenges as brothers, friends and neighbors, we support the devastated communities that are affected. We pray for their recovery and their overcoming of all challenges. We all belong to God, and should He call us back may He give strength to the loved ones we leave behind. As a youth auxiliary pledging service to our nation and countrymen, we are merging with Humanity First in providing volunteers to affected families.

HowardUniversityLawIn 2011, a Florida pastor made international news when he publicly burned a copy of the Qur’an, followed by scattered protests resulting in the deaths of at least 12 individuals in Afghanistan. This event, and dozens of similar events that took place previously, have sparked national discussions in the U.S. around the rights and responsibilities of free speech. During this event, Qasim Rashid will premier a paper that seeks to resolve both the constitutional and the safety concerns around events like the Qur’an burnings.

Qasim Rashid is an award winning member of the Muslim Writers Guild of America and emerging legal scholar. The paper he will present is titled “In Harm’s Way: The Desperate Need to Update America’s Current Free Speech Model.” A Q&A session will follow the lecture.
